Mechanical thrombectomy is a standard treatment for acute stroke, but it can be technically challenging in elderly patients with difficult vascular anatomy. To overcome this issue, we propose a new endovascular approach called the "tightrope" technique. This technique uses a stiff guidewire and a standard angiographic catheter to straighten the internal carotid artery (ICA) tortuosity, allowing the guiding catheter to be positioned next to the intracranial level. We retrospectively evaluated all the procedures in which the "tightrope" technique was used. This approach involves advancing a 0.035″ Advantage stiff guidewire and a standard 4 Fr angiographic catheter through the vascular tortuosity. The catheter is twisted over the guide wire in a clockwise direction, gaining tension that gradually straightens the vascular axis, allowing the guiding catheter to pass up to the distal ICA. Between June 2022 and March 2023, we successfully performed consecutive mechanical thrombectomy procedures using the tightrope technique in 11 patients with highly tortuous ICA segments. In all cases, we were able to safely advance the catheter system up to the distal cervical ICA. Although our study included a small cohort of patients, the "tightrope" technique proved to be successful in all patients, allowing for safe advancement of the guiding catheter toward extremely tortuous anatomy. However, further validation in a larger patient population is necessary to determine the technique's effectiveness and safety profile.

A patient with a therapy-related acute myeloid leukaemia (AML), NPM1mut, and FLT3-ITD+ was treated with induction and consolidation with CPX-351, obtaining a complete response (CR) but minimal residual disease persisted positive. Later, she complained progressive burning leg pain, weakening of the right hand and leg muscles, associated with absence of osteotendinous leg reflexes. Examination of cerebrospinal fluid (CSF) showed a meningeal relapse of AML. Moreover, a magnetic resonance imaging (MRI) showed 2 right meningeal implants of myeloid sarcoma and bone marrow revealed haematologic relapse of disease. She was treated with medicated lumbar punctures (LPs) followed by an FLA-Ida scheme, and she achieved a 2nd CR. Unfortunately, the patient developed hyperleucocytosis and reappearance of meningeal myeloid sarcoma at MRI. For this reason, a monotherapy with gilteritinib (an FLT3 inhibitor) was started: after 3 months of therapy, central nervous system (CNS)-disease shrunken and then faded, while AML in the bone marrow achieved only a partial response. This is the 1st report of a positive biological effect of gilteritinib on CNS (meningeal) myeloid sarcoma. There are no studies of gilteritinib concentration into CSF and penetration of gilteritinib into the blood-brain barrier should be further studied, given the paucity of drugs active on CNS relapse of AML. In patients receiving CPX-351 only, diagnostic LP should be considered after induction.
